The Three Musketeers
Alexandre Dumas’s The Three Musketeers is a classic historical adventure set in 17th-century France. This revised Oxford World's Classics edition features a fresh and modernized translation, alongside an introduction and notes by David Coward. The novel follows the spirited young d’Artagnan and his three musketeer friends—Athos, Porthos, and Aramis—through a tale of honor, loyalty, and political conspiracy.
